HSIC Stock Benefits From Expanded Partnership With vVARDIS
ZACKS· 2025-12-02 14:26
Core Insights - Henry Schein, Inc. (HSIC) has expanded its agreement with vVARDIS, gaining exclusive U.S. distribution rights for the drill-free Curodont Repair Fluoride Plus product, effective January 1, 2026, which is expected to enhance the company's Dental business [1][8] - Following the announcement, HSIC shares increased by 0.1%, closing at $73.15 in after-market trading [2] - The company's revenue growth is supported by niche acquisitions and partnerships, with expectations for the latest news to bolster stock performance [3] Company Developments - Curodont is a proprietary solution for treating early-stage cavities without drills or needles, addressing a significant unmet need in dental care [5][6] - The expanded partnership with vVARDIS will enhance Henry Schein's reach across various dental care areas, including general dentistry, orthodontics, and pediatric dentistry [7][8] - Henry Schein is currently the market leader in selling Curodont to general practitioners and Dental Service Organizations (DSOs) in the U.S. and holds exclusive distribution rights in the U.K. [9] Market Outlook - The global dental caries treatment market is projected to grow from $8.01 billion in 2025 to approximately $12.11 billion by 2034, at a CAGR of 4.70% [10] - The rising prevalence of dental diseases necessitates effective treatment options, which supports the growth of the dental caries treatment market [10] Additional Innovations - Henry Schein's dental software business has introduced AI and automation workflows to enhance operational efficiency for dental practices [11] Stock Performance - Year-to-date, HSIC shares have increased by 5.7%, compared to the industry's growth of 15.6% [12]
HSIC Stock Set to Benefit From Henry Schein One's Workflow Launch
ZACKS· 2025-12-01 13:56
Core Insights - Henry Schein's dental software business, Henry Schein One, has introduced natively embedded AI and automation workflows to enhance dental practices [1][9] - The integration of AWS' generative AI technologies aims to revolutionize the dental industry by improving efficiency and accuracy [2] - Despite a recent decline in HSIC shares, there is potential for recovery due to the comprehensive nature of the new AI tools [3][9] Company Developments - Henry Schein One's new Forms workflow accelerates record entry by capturing insurance data from patient cards, while Eligibility Pro ensures accurate benefit information [5] - The Detect AI tool, powered by VideaHealth, aids in diagnosing dental issues through FDA-cleared algorithms, enhancing patient understanding and treatment acceptance [6] - The Voice Notes feature utilizes generative AI to transcribe chairside conversations into clinical records, reducing administrative burdens [7] Financial Performance - Henry Schein currently has a market capitalization of $8.78 billion, with a projected 3.6% growth in earnings per share (EPS) for 2025 [4] - The company reported total net sales of $3.3 billion for Q3 2025, reflecting a year-over-year growth of 5.2% across all segments [12] - HSIC shares have increased by 15.4% over the past month, outperforming the industry average of 7.9% [13] Industry Prospects - The global AI-powered dental workflow platforms market is valued at $415.8 million in 2024, with a projected comp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.1% through 2032 [11]
Henry Schein One Unveils Industry-first Natively Embedded Voice Workflow at 2025 Greater New York Dental Meeting
Businesswire· 2025-11-25 11:30
Core Insights - Henry Schein One has introduced natively embedded AI and automation workflows in its Dentrix and Dentrix Ascend platforms, focusing on improving clean claims and operational efficiency [1][2][10] Group 1: AI and Automation Integration - The company aims for a comprehensive integration of AI across all practice operations, enhancing time efficiency, accuracy, and profit margins [2][9] - New features include Voice Notes for real-time transcription of chairside conversations, reducing administrative burdens and improving patient care [7][8] Group 2: Enhanced Patient Interaction - The Forms workflow allows for quicker and more accurate patient record entry by capturing insurance data from a photo of the patient's card [3][4] - Eligibility Pro provides real-time insurance benefits, ensuring accurate patient information before appointments [4] Group 3: Diagnostic and Treatment Support - Detect AI, powered by VideaHealth, assists in diagnosing dental issues with FDA-cleared algorithms, enhancing patient understanding and treatment acceptance [5][10] - The integration of AI-driven tools aims to improve clinical documentation and coding for cleaner claims [10] Group 4: Future Developments - Henry Schein One plans to introduce predictive tools for scheduling and case acceptance, along with unified analytics dashboards for comprehensive performance monitoring [10][11]
